Position Overview :
The Video Editor position is responsible for producing high-quality, engaging visual content that supports the University's branding, marketing, and communication objectives across digital platforms. The ideal candidate should be passionate about storytelling, have strong video editing and motion design skills, and can independently manage projects from concept to final delivery. This role requires a strong understanding of branding, social media content, AI-powered video creation, and post-production workflows.
Key Responsibilities :
- Edit and produce high-quality videos for social media, websites, advertisements, campaigns, and presentations.
- Create product explainer videos, demo reels, promotional videos, and feature highlight content.
- Design and integrate motion graphics, 2D animations, titles, transitions, and visual effects to enhance video content.
- Perform colour correction and colour grading to ensure visual consistency and premium output.
- Edit raw footage, voiceovers, screen recordings, and audio into polished, brand-aligned videos.
- Develop animated creatives for platforms including Instagram, LinkedIn, YouTube, Facebook, and other digital channels.
- Ensure all content adheres to brand guidelines and platform-specific best practices.
- Manage multiple projects simultaneously while meeting de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
- Collaborate with marketing, design, and content teams to translate creative briefs into compelling visual stories.
- Stay updated with the latest video production techniques, AI tools, design trends, and platform requirements.
Knowledge & Skills:
- Proficiency in Adobe Photoshop, Adobe Illustrator, Canva, and Figma
- Proficiency in DaVinci Resolve for professional video editing and colour grading
- Experience in creating motion graphics, animations, and visual effects for digital media
- Familiarity with AI-assisted video editing technologies and digital content creation trends
- Ability to edit and colour grade LOG footage, including Sony S-Log3 and DJI D-Log formats
- Working knowledge of Adobe Premiere Pro, Adobe After Effects, Final Cut Pro, and CapCut
- Understanding of visual storytelling, branding principles, typography, composition, and colour theory
- Sound knowledge of video production, editing techniques, motion graphics, and post-production workflows
- Knowledge of video formats, codecs, compression techniques, export settings, and platform optimisation
